Output d75399a16f997626a08ff71e1971ac8a8879f8fb2b1c5859ea17e4105a1e3c98:1

value
104248934
script pubkey
OP_0 OP_PUSHBYTES_20 45a3f23649f60fa435977131d98413777b6bbe98
address
bc1qgk3lydjf7c86gdvhwycanpqnwaakh05chrsay5
transaction
d75399a16f997626a08ff71e1971ac8a8879f8fb2b1c5859ea17e4105a1e3c98
spent
true